How does reporting work right after a crash?
Report collisions to police and insurer promptly. Exchange basic details, avoid fault discussions, and gather contact information.
What should you avoid doing at the scene?
Do not admit blame or sign statements hastily. Seek medical checks and legal advice before completing claims.
